学生信息管理系统

我们提供学生信息管理系统招投标所需全套资料,包括学工系统介绍PPT、学生管理系统产品解决方案、
学生管理系统产品技术参数,以及对应的标书参考文件,详请联系客服。

基于长春地区高校的学工管理系统技术实现与应用分析

2026-04-07 00:54
学生管理系统在线试用
学生管理系统
在线试用
学生管理系统解决方案
学生管理系统
解决方案下载
学生管理系统源码
学生管理系统
详细介绍
学生管理系统报价
学生管理系统
产品报价

随着高等教育信息化进程的不断加快,学工管理系统作为高校管理的重要组成部分,逐渐成为提升教学管理效率、优化学生服务的重要工具。特别是在长春这样的教育重镇,多所高等院校对学工系统的依赖程度日益加深。本文将围绕“学工管理系统”与“长春”这一主题,结合“大学”背景,深入探讨该系统的构建与实现,并提供具体的代码示例,以展示其技术实现过程。

一、引言

在信息化时代背景下,高校学生管理工作面临着前所未有的挑战。传统的手工操作方式不仅效率低下,而且容易出错。因此,构建一个高效、稳定、安全的学工管理系统显得尤为重要。长春作为东北地区重要的教育中心,拥有众多高校,如吉林大学、长春理工大学等,这些高校在学工管理方面的需求尤为突出。本文将结合长春地区的高校实际情况,探讨学工管理系统的开发与应用。

二、学工管理系统概述

学工管理系统是用于学生信息管理、成绩管理、奖惩记录、活动组织等工作的软件系统。它通常包括学生基本信息管理、课程管理、考勤管理、成绩录入与查询、奖学金评定、违纪处理等功能模块。通过该系统,学校可以实现对学生信息的集中管理,提高工作效率,减少人为错误,同时为学生提供更加便捷的服务。

2.1 系统架构设计

学工管理系统的架构通常采用分层设计,包括前端界面、后端逻辑处理、数据库存储等部分。前端负责用户交互,后端处理业务逻辑,数据库则用于数据的持久化存储。在长春地区的高校中,常见的技术栈包括Java Web、Python Django、Spring Boot等框架,配合MySQL或PostgreSQL数据库。

2.2 功能模块

学工管理系统的功能模块主要包括以下几个方面:

学生信息管理:包括学生基本信息、学籍状态、联系方式等。

课程与成绩管理:支持课程信息录入、成绩录入与查询。

考勤管理:记录学生的出勤情况,支持多种考勤方式。

奖惩管理:记录学生的奖惩情况,便于奖学金评定与违纪处理。

活动管理:组织并管理各类学生活动,如讲座、竞赛等。

三、基于长春高校的学工管理系统实现

为了更好地适应长春高校的实际需求,学工管理系统的设计需要充分考虑本地化因素。例如,某些高校可能有特定的学生管理模式,或者需要与现有系统进行集成。因此,在系统开发过程中,应注重模块化设计,以便于后期扩展与维护。

3.1 技术选型

在技术选型方面,建议采用主流的Web开发技术栈,如Spring Boot + MyBatis + MySQL组合,以保证系统的稳定性与可扩展性。同时,前端可以使用Vue.js或React进行开发,以提供良好的用户体验。

3.2 系统开发流程

学工管理系统的开发通常包括以下几个阶段:

需求分析:与高校相关部门沟通,明确系统功能需求。

系统设计:根据需求设计系统架构、数据库模型及接口。

开发实现:按照设计文档进行编码,完成各个功能模块。

测试与部署:进行系统测试,确保功能正常运行后部署上线。

四、学工管理系统代码示例

以下是一个简单的学工管理系统的学生信息管理模块的代码示例,使用Java语言编写,基于Spring Boot框架。

学生信息管理系统


package com.example.studentmanagement.controller;

import com.example.studentmanagement.model.Student;
import com.example.studentmanagement.service.StudentService;
import org.springframework.beans.factory.annotation.Autowired;
import org.springframework.web.bind.annotation.*;

import java.util.List;

@RestController
@RequestMapping("/students")
public class StudentController {

    @Autowired
    private StudentService studentService;

    @GetMapping("/")
    public List getAllStudents() {
        return studentService.getAllStudents();
    }

    @PostMapping("/")
    public Student createStudent(@RequestBody Student student) {
        return studentService.createStudent(student);
    }

    @GetMapping("/{id}")
    public Student getStudentById(@PathVariable Long id) {
        return studentService.getStudentById(id);
    }

    @PutMapping("/{id}")
    public Student updateStudent(@PathVariable Long id, @RequestBody Student student) {
        return studentService.updateStudent(id, student);
    }

    @DeleteMapping("/{id}")
    public void deleteStudent(@PathVariable Long id) {
        studentService.deleteStudent(id);
    }
}
    

上述代码展示了学生信息管理的基本CRUD操作,包括获取所有学生信息、创建学生、根据ID获取学生信息、更新学生信息以及删除学生信息。该代码基于Spring Boot框架,适用于高校学工管理系统的开发。

五、学工管理系统在长春高校的应用案例

在长春地区,一些高校已经成功部署了学工管理系统,取得了显著的效果。例如,长春理工大学通过引入学工管理系统,实现了对学生信息的统一管理,提高了教务工作的效率,同时也增强了学生的服务体验。

5.1 系统优势

学工管理系统的应用带来了诸多优势,包括:

提高管理效率:自动化处理学生信息,减少人工操作。

增强数据安全性:通过权限控制与加密技术,保护学生隐私。

提升服务质量:学生可以通过系统自助查询信息,减少等待时间。

支持数据分析:系统可以生成统计报表,为学校决策提供数据支持。

5.2 面临的挑战

尽管学工管理系统带来了诸多好处,但在实际应用中也面临一些挑战,如系统维护成本高、用户培训难度大、数据兼容性问题等。因此,高校在部署系统时,应充分考虑这些问题,并制定相应的解决方案。

六、未来发展趋势

学工管理系统

随着人工智能、大数据等技术的发展,学工管理系统也将迎来新的发展机遇。未来的学工管理系统可能会具备更强的数据分析能力,能够根据学生的行为模式进行预测与干预,从而提升教育质量。

6.1 智能化趋势

未来,学工管理系统可能会引入AI技术,如自然语言处理(NLP)用于自动回复学生咨询,机器学习用于学生行为分析等。这将大大提升系统的智能化水平,使学生管理更加精准与高效。

6.2 移动化发展

随着移动设备的普及,学工管理系统也将逐步向移动端迁移,提供更加便捷的访问方式。学生可以通过手机随时查看自己的信息、提交申请、参与活动等,极大提升了用户体验。

七、结论

综上所述,学工管理系统在长春高校的管理工作中发挥着重要作用。通过合理的技术选型与系统设计,可以有效提升学生管理的效率与质量。本文提供的代码示例为学工管理系统的开发提供了参考,同时也展示了其在高校中的实际应用价值。未来,随着技术的不断发展,学工管理系统将朝着更加智能、高效的方向发展,为高校教育管理提供更强大的技术支持。

本站部分内容及素材来源于互联网,由AI智能生成,如有侵权或言论不当,联系必删!